Combination Design Properties

Properties specific to the combination chart are described below. For general configuration options, see Generic Views Properties, which apply to all view types.

To access these properties, first create or open a combination chart. Then, from the Toolbar panel on the right, select Chart Properties and open the Design tab.

Category Axis

Data Labels

OptionDescription
TextEnter a label for the category axis.
Label OrientationSet the label angle in degrees to improve readability, especially with long or overlapping labels.
Label StepDefine how often labels appear on the axis. For example, a value of 2 shows one label out of every two, skipping the ones in between.

Grid Lines

Display grid lines along the category axis to make comparisons easier when reading values across bars.
